Output e6083c91c50371f6919ff803315e6611f3bb3d21a164efd26e392aca19935b18:4

value
5925397
script pubkey
OP_0 OP_PUSHBYTES_20 ca91f3cea7c0f1ed576c9ed1d18b7751621878a5
address
bc1qe2gl8n48crc764mvnmgarzmh293ps7997uwflr
transaction
e6083c91c50371f6919ff803315e6611f3bb3d21a164efd26e392aca19935b18